  • Weekly Pool Cleaning & MaintenanceWeekly pool service in El Paso runs $100 to $250 a month depending on pool size, tree load, and whether filter cleaning and salt cell descaling are included. A proper visit is not a lap with a net: we test and balance, brush walls and the waterline, empty skimmer and pump baskets, check filter pressure against its clean baseline, inspect the equipment pad, and flag anything trending the wrong way.
  • Green Pool Cleanup & Acid WashingGreen pool cleanup in El Paso usually takes three to seven days of chemical recovery and rarely needs the pool drained, which is exactly how we prefer to do it. Draining a shell in this climate exposes bare plaster to brutal sun and single-digit humidity, and a surface left dry in July can craze in hours, so the chemical route is both cheaper for you and safer for the pool.
  • Pool Safety Fences & CoversPool safety fence and cover installation in El Paso keeps your pool compliant with local barrier requirements and, far more importantly, keeps a small child out of the water when nobody is watching. A residential barrier here generally needs to stand at least 48 inches high with no climbable footholds, gaps too narrow for a child to pass, and a self-closing, self-latching gate that swings away from the pool with the latch mounted out of reach.
  • Commercial Pool Construction & ServiceCommercial pool construction and service in El Paso is judged on turnover rates and compliance paperwork, not on tile selection. Texas public pools fall under 25 TAC Chapter 265 and Health and Safety Code Chapter 757, which means compliant enclosures, VGB anti-entrapment main drain covers, correct turnover for volume and bather load, working flow meters and gauges, accurate depth and rule signage, and daily chemical logs an inspector can read without squinting.
  • Pool Demolition & RemovalPool removal in El Paso is a permitted demolition job with two legitimate approaches, and choosing the wrong one costs you either money now or resale value later. A partial fill-in breaks holes through the floor for drainage, collapses the upper walls into the cavity, and backfills with engineered fill placed and compacted in lifts.
